Configure the BSP for the desired hardware platform and software configuration using the correpsonding command from the following table:

Platform Configuration Command
MBa7x linux/mainline ¦ busybox init ¦ Qt5 tools/config-mba7x
linux/mainline ¦ busybox init tools/config-mba7x.tiny
linux/mainline ¦ systemd init tools/config-mba7x.sd

Building the BSP:

Execute in the BSP root directory

$ ./tools/config-mba7x
$ ./p images

or

$ ptxdist platform configs/platform-tq-tqma7x/mba7x/platformconfig
$ ptxdist select configs/platform-tq-tqma7x/ptxconfig.qt
$ ptxdist go --git
$ ptxdist images

SD / eMMC Image

  • sector size 512 Byte
  • unpartitioned area: 4MiB (0x2000 sectors)

Sector numbers are in hexadecimal (as expected by U-Boot's mmc command), size is given in hex (=number of sectors) and dezimal (= size in byte).

Sector first Sector last Size Usage
0x000000 0x000000 0x0001 sector / 512 Byte MBR / Partition Table
0x000001 0x000001 0x0001 sector / 512 Byte free
0x000002 0x0007FF 0x07FE sectors / 1023 KiB u-boot
0x000800 0x000FFF 0x0800 sectors / 1 MiB u-boot environment
0x001000 0x001FFF 0x1000 sectors / 2 MiB free
0x002000 0x00BFFF 0xA000 sectors / 20 MiB boot / firmware (Kernel, devicetrees)
0x00C000 0x08BFFF 0x80000 sectors / 256 MiB root
0x08C000 0x10BFFF 0x80000 sectors / 256 MiB spare, unformatted

BSP Version History

Rev.0115

BSP

  • Update to Yocto Kirkstone
  • Update to Linux kernel 5.15.55 and 5.15.55-rt48

Rev.0114

BSP

  • Update to Yocto Hardknott
  • Update to Linux kernel 5.15.27

Rev.0111

BSP

  • Update to Linux Mainline 5.4 ( rt patches available)
  • Update to NXP v2019.04-lf-5.4.y-1.0.0
  • Fixed a resource allocation issue in the TLV320AIC32x4 audio codec driver that could lead to warnings and lockups during boot or shutdown
  • Fixed incorrect clock setup in the TLV320AIC32x4 audio codec driver causing too slow or too fast playback and recording after a soft reboot

Linux

  • The kernel configuration was changed to use the better supported mainline graphics stack
  • Fixed a QSPI driver bug causing frequent corruptions of filesystems on SPI-NOR flash
  • Enabled cpufreq driver in kernel defconfig
